Output 8bec5346a4439b8f6262d56f75f3562813488eecdfe879da402dbbd32f07daf3:0

value
8853614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75a90ef33e8c91305564e7aeaa48b7aaf3001153 OP_EQUALVERIFY OP_CHECKSIG
address
1Bj8aq1EuTcxuDVphKUZWEXTuUfuSfLh6j
transaction
8bec5346a4439b8f6262d56f75f3562813488eecdfe879da402dbbd32f07daf3
spent
true